Billy Elekana has withdrawn from his scheduled light heavyweight bout against undefeated prospect Iwo Baraniewski at UFC Vegas 118 on June 6, cancelling the matchup. Baraniewski, who enters with an 8-0 record featuring multiple first-round knockouts in the UFC and on Dana White’s Contender Series, will now face Junior Tafa instead. Elekana, 10-2 with recent submission victories including one over Tafa, provided no public reason for the pullout. The change shifts focus to Baraniewski’s continued momentum against a new opponent on short notice while highlighting the volatility of fight card matchups at 205 pounds.
